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1178568607 76633 0413232580
1822535 62833715612
1822535 62833715612
6975798309 672111 22698150
All about undefined
Interested in learning more?
1822535 62833715612
6975798309 672111 22698150
See more
09534092388 7140
215 51228057 447671572
See more
17911 4632215604 08063503693
691090 3065 974535167
See more